TYO:6742 Revenue
Kyosan Electric Manufacturing had revenue of 20.05B JPY in the quarter ending December 31, 2024, with 34.89%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 77.98B, up 20.13% year-over-year. In the fiscal year ending March 31, 2024, Kyosan Electric Manufacturing had annual revenue of 70.53B, down -2.49%.

Revenue History
Fiscal Year End | Revenue | Change | Growth |
---|---|---|---|
Mar 31, 2024 | 70.53B | -1.80B | -2.49% |
Mar 31, 2023 | 72.33B | -589.00M | -0.81% |
Mar 31, 2022 | 72.92B | 10.70B | 17.19% |
Mar 31, 2021 | 62.22B | -10.59B | -14.55% |
Mar 31, 2020 | 72.81B | 3.51B | 5.06% |

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
